Cardano DEX and the Potential of copyright Trades

In the ever-evolving landscape of digital fund, decentralized exchanges (DEXs) have surfaced as strong systems that redefine the way in which people talk with cryptocurrencies. Unlike traditional centralized transactions, Cardano DEX offer a peer-to-peer trading design wherever customers maintain full control over their electronic resources without relying on intermediaries. Among these decentralized systems, those developed on Cardano's blockchain infrastructure are getting increasing attention because of their impressive way of scalability, security, and intelligent agreement functionality.

Cardano, a third-generation blockchain, is notable by its research-driven progress and layered structure, rendering it especially suited to hosting strong decentralized applications—including DEX platforms. A Cardano-based DEX allows people to exchange tokens directly on the blockchain, utilizing smart agreements to execute trades automatically and transparently. These wise agreements are prepared in Plutus, Cardano's native development language, noted for their conventional proof functions that lessen vulnerabilities in rule execution.

Among the critical characteristics that units Cardano DEX systems aside is their focus on scalability and low transaction fees. As congestion and large gasoline costs affect several other communities, Cardano utilizes a unique agreement system called Ouroboros, which provides both power effectiveness and the ability to range as person need grows. This framework helps quicker and more affordable copyright trades, which makes it an fascinating selection for both informal consumers and institutional participants.
